Oracle索引优化:常见问题与解决方案集锦

原创 本是古典 何须时尚 2024-12-19 16:12 94阅读 0赞

在Oracle数据库中,索引的优化是非常关键的一环。以下是常遇到的一些问题以及对应的解决方案:

  1. 过多的索引导致性能下降
    解决方案:对表进行全扫描分析,找出频繁查询的字段,然后创建这些字段的索引。

  2. 不合理的索引类型选择
    解决方案:根据查询条件的特性,选择最合适的索引类型。例如,对于等值查询,可以使用BTree索引;对于范围查询,可以选择RTree或Hash索引。

  3. 动态重载导致索引失效
    解决方案:确保在更新列时,不执行动态重载。可以通过设置SQL语法选项来避免。

  4. 表空间不足导致索引创建失败
    解决方案:确保表空间有足够的空间用于索引的创建。可以使用ALTER TABLE ... RESIZE命令来调整空间分配。

通过上述解决方案,你可以在处理Oracle索引优化问题时更加得心应手。

文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,94人围观)

还没有评论,来说两句吧...

相关阅读